Senior Professional in Human Resources (SPHR)

What is Senior Professional in Human Resources (SPHR)?

 

‘Senior Professional in Human Resources’, abbreviated as SPHR is an official certification from the HRCI which certifies HRs with 6 to 8 years of experience in the complex fields related to HR as well as having a comprehensive knowledge of the business processes and the common practices.

 

The certification can be achieved by giving their exams which tests the HR’s knowledge in multiple business areas in the following pattern:

 

  • Business management and strategy: 30%
  • Compensation and benefits: 13%
  • Employee and labour relations: 14
  • Human resource development: 19%
  • Risk management: 7%
  • Workforce planning and employment: 17%
  • The exam consists of 175 multiple choice questions that need to be answered within a time period of 3 hours.
